在Linux系統中,配置服務通常涉及以下幾個步驟:
- 確定服務類型:首先,你需要明確你要配置的服務是什么。這可能是一個Web服務器(如Apache或Nginx)、數據庫服務器(如MySQL或PostgreSQL)、文件服務器(如Samba)等。
- 安裝必要的軟件包:大多數Linux發行版都有一個包管理器,如apt(Debian/Ubuntu)、yum(RHEL/CentOS/Fedora)或pacman(Arch Linux)。使用包管理器安裝所需的服務軟件包。
- 查找配置文件:服務通常會有一個或多個配置文件,這些文件包含了服務的設置信息。你可以通過服務器的文檔或搜索常見的位置來找到這些文件。例如,Apache的配置文件通常位于
/etc/apache2/
或/etc/httpd/
目錄下。
- 編輯配置文件:使用文本編輯器(如nano、vim或gedit)打開配置文件,并根據需要進行修改。配置文件通常包含指令和選項,用于定義服務的行為。請確保你了解每個指令的含義,以避免不必要的問題。
- 保存并退出:在編輯完配置文件后,保存更改并退出編輯器。
- 測試配置:在重啟服務之前,建議先測試配置文件的語法是否正確。大多數服務都提供了一個命令來檢查配置文件的語法。例如,對于Apache,你可以運行
apachectl configtest
。
- 重啟服務:如果配置文件沒有問題,你可以使用服務器的啟動腳本或服務管理器來重啟服務。例如,在Debian/Ubuntu上,你可以使用
sudo systemctl restart apache2
來重啟Apache服務。
- 驗證服務狀態:最后,你可以使用服務器的命令或工具來驗證服務是否已成功啟動并正在運行。例如,你可以使用
sudo systemctl status apache2
來查看Apache服務的狀態。
請注意,不同的Linux發行版和服務可能會有所不同,因此上述步驟可能需要根據你的具體情況進行一些調整。此外,強烈建議在修改配置文件之前創建備份,以防止出現問題時無法恢復。